EXTRADITION (APPLICATION TO THE UNITED STATES) ORDER

(SECTION 4) [Commencement 20th September, 1994]

WHEREAS an Extradition Treaty was signed on the 9th day of March, 1990 between the Government of the Commonwealth of The Bahamas and the Government of the United States of America.

NOW in pursuance of the powers vested in him by section 4(1) of the Extradition Act, 1994 the Minister makes the following Order:

1. This Order may be cited as the Extradition (Application to the United States) Order.

2. The provisions of the Act shall apply to the United States of America.

EXTRADITION (APPLICATION TO FOREIGN STATES) ORDER

(SECTION 4) [Commencement 2nd November, 1994]

1. This Order may be cited as the Extradition (Application to Foreign States) Order.

2. The provisions of the Act shall apply to the countries named in the Schedule and each being a country with whom there exists an extradition treaty or agreement with The Bahamas.
